A proliferation-inducing ligand (APRIL), also known as tumor necrosis factor ligand superfamily member 13 (TNFSF13), is a protein of the TNF superfamily recognized by the cell surface receptor TACI. It is encoded by the TNFSF13 gene.The protein encoded by this gene is a member of the tumor necrosis factor ligand (TNF) ligand family. This protein is a ligand for TNFRSF17/BCMA, a member of the TNF receptor family. This protein and its receptor are both found to be important for B cell development. In vivo experiments suggest an important role for APRIL in the long-term survival of plasma cells in the bone marrow. Mice deficient in APRIL have normal immune system development.| Typical data
As the OD values of the standard curve may vary according to the conditions of the actual assay performance (e.g. operator, pipetting technique, wash technique or temperature effects), the operator should establish a standard curve for each test. Typical standard curve and data are provided below for reference only.Concentration (pg/mL) | 3000 | 1500 | 750 | 375 | 187.5 | 93.7 | 46.8 | 0 |
OD | 2.35 | 1.35 | 0.8 | 0.48 | 0.34 | 0.26 | 0.22 | 0.09 |
Corrected OD | 2.26 | 1.26 | 0.71 | 0.39 | 0.25 | 0.17 | 0.13 | - |
